By Type:The fertilizer market is segmented into various types, including nitrogen fertilizers, phosphate fertilizers, potash fertilizers, compound/complex fertilizers, organic & biofertilizers, specialty & enhanced-efficiency fertilizers, and others. Among these, nitrogen fertilizers dominate the market due to their essential role in crop growth and high demand from farmers seeking to maximize yields; global market analyses consistently show nitrogen products as the largest segment by value and volume . The increasing focus on sustainable agriculture has also led to a rise in the adoption of organic and biofertilizers and enhanced-efficiency fertilizers to improve nutrient-use efficiency and reduce losses, although they currently hold a smaller market share compared to nitrogen fertilizers .

By Application Method:The application methods for fertilizers include soil application, foliar application, fertigation, and seed treatment/coating. Soil application remains the most widely used method due to its simplicity and effectiveness in delivering nutrients directly to the root zone of crops; precision placement and banding techniques are increasingly used to improve efficiency . However, fertigation is gaining traction as it allows for precise nutrient delivery and water management—especially in high-value horticulture and water-scarce regions—aligning with broader adoption of drip and micro-irrigation systems .

| Segment | Sub-Segments |
|---|---|
| By Type | Nitrogen Fertilizers (Urea, Ammonium Nitrate, Ammonium Sulfate, UAN) Phosphate Fertilizers (DAP, MAP, TSP, SSP) Potash Fertilizers (MOP/Potassium Chloride, SOP/Potassium Sulfate, Others) Compound/Complex Fertilizers (NPK, NP, PK) Organic & Biofertilizers (Compost/Manure, Microbial/Biofertilizers, Seaweed/Other Organics) Specialty & Enhanced-Efficiency Fertilizers (CRF/SRF, Water-Soluble, Micronutrients, Inhibitor-treated) Others (Secondary Nutrients—Ca, Mg, S) |
| By Application Method | Soil Application Foliar Application Fertigation Seed Treatment/Coating |
| By Crop | Cereals & Grains (Wheat, Corn, Rice, Others) Oilseeds & Pulses Fruits & Vegetables Turf, Ornamentals & Plantation Crops Others (Forage, Sugar Crops, Fiber Crops) |
| By End-User | Smallholder Farmers Commercial Farms & Agribusinesses Agricultural Cooperatives Landscape & Horticulture Enterprises Distributors & Retail Networks |
| By Distribution Channel | Direct/Industrial Offtake (Large Farms, Blenders) Dealer/Distributor Networks Retail Stores & Ag-Inputs Retailers Online & E-commerce Platforms Government Procurement & Subsidy Channels |
| By Form | Dry/Granular Liquid Water-Soluble Powders |
| By Region | North America Europe Asia-Pacific Latin America Middle East & Africa |
